1976 saw the debut of a new Lotus Grand Prix car, the Type 77.
Colin Chapman described it as the "fully adjustable car", explaining that its dimensions were variable to suit a range of circuit conditions.

The introduction of the new car also saw the signing of two new drivers, Mario Andretti and Gunner Nilsson who would aim to return Lotus to the front.
Peterson had now fulfilled his contract, though he raced the first Grand Prix for Lotus before joining the March team.

Round 1 saw a double retirement for Lotus. Not the best start to the season.
The next two rounds saw Andretti driving a Parnelli, so his Lotus was taken over by Bob Evans, who finished 10th in the South African Grand Prix but failed to qualify for the Long Beach race.
These two events saw two retirements for Nilsson, though the next round in Spain gave him a well-earned 3rd place. Andretti returned to Lotus in Spain, though that race and the following Belgian Grand Prix heralded two retirements.
Andretti missed the Monaco Grand Prix to race at Indianapolis, but returned at the Swedish Grand Prix where he retired, but had the consolation of setting fastest lap.
The following race in France gave Andretti his first points of the season with a 5th place finish.
A 5th place was also earned by Gunner Nilsson in the German Grand Prix two races later.
The following Austrian Grand Prix gave Lotus a double points finish with Nilsson 3rd and Andretti 5th. Andretti earned a 3rd place in the Dutch Grand Prix 1 race later.
Canada gave Andretti another 3rd place before the highlight of 1976. Pole and win for Andretti, 6th place for Nilsson in the final round of the season in Japan, Lotus were back.

The final round flourish made the final Championship tables look much more respectable for Lotus.
4th place in the Constructors Championship while Andretti was 6th and Nilsson 10th in the Drivers Championship.


GP Starts:: 16

Wins:: 1

Poles:: 1

Points Scored:: 33

DRIVERS::

Mario Andretti:: 13 Starts, 1 Win, 21 Points
Gunnar Nilsson:: 15 Starts, 11 Points
Ronnie Peterson:: 1 Start
Bob Evans:: 1 Start
